4. nightpool ◴[] No.43709909{3}[source]
https://arxiv.org/pdf/2206.02285

    In this work we find that many current redactions of PDF text are insecure due to non-redacted character positioning information. In particular, subpixel-sized horizontal shifts in redacted and non-redacted characters can be recovered and used to effectively deredact first and last names.
Information-theoretic attacks work on black boxes too
